Beautiful court or society sword from the Napoleon III period, triangular blade with three hollow sides, one-third blued and gilded, frame in cast bronze, chased and gilded. Four-lobed pommel, two leonine masks on the sides, two busts of Athena on the faces. A single, flat guard arm decorated with foliage emerging from a snout and joined to the cruciate guard by a fiddlehead scroll. Flat quillon engraved on the front with a Heliotrope flower, guard plate decorated with a dextrogyrated uncrowned imperial eagle on a thunderbolt, framed by a laurel branch and an oak branch. The spindle is covered with mother-of-pearl plates striated lengthwise. No scabbard (Condition 1).
